Child Abuse Prevention Month
The 2020 Child Abuse Prevention Month campaign theme, Stand Up for MilKids,
aims to raise awareness of a key protective factor shown to increase
children's resilience: the stability of a caring adult in their lives -
whether a family member, teacher, coach or another positive figure. A caring
adult with a steady presence in a child's life can be a source of trust and
support, and is especially important for kids with Adverse Childhood
Experiences, or ACEs. Children who grow up with such an adult in their lives
are significantly more likely to develop healthy social behaviors and
positive coping skills that will help them to weather life's difficulties,
including abuse and neglect.
If you do have concerns about a child's safety, know what to do. Call your
installation Family Advocacy Program or the Childhelp National Child Abuse
Hotline at 800-422-4453. If you're not sure what to do, you can always
contact Military OneSource at 800-342-9647. Reporting suspected child abuse
is required by law for military chain of command and covered professionals
and is always the right thing to do.

- Military Saves Campaign
-
Military Saves is a campaign that encourages the entire military community to
make a pledge to save money. The campaign offers an opportunity for
organizations to promote savings year-round and especially during Military
Saves Month in April. Military Saves also works with government agencies, DoD
installation credit unions and banks, as well as, other non-profit
organizations to promote savings and debt reduction.
Each week in April Military Saves features highlighted programs. (Apr. 1-4 is
Save Automatically, Apr. 6-10 is Save to Retire, Apr. 13-18 is Save for the
Unexpected, Apr. 20-25 is Save with a Plan and the final week, Apr. 27-30 is
Save by Paying Down Debt.) Head over to militarysaves.org for more
information and to make your pledge to save today!

Due to the increasing precautionary measures for the health protection of
the community, including restricted face-to-face support, Military and
Family Life Counselors (MFLC) and Youth Behavioral Military Family Life
Counselors (CYB-MFLC) are now temporarily able to provide telehealth
services so that they can continue care for the local community. Services
will include non-medical counseling via phone or video.
Support for Adults:
- Non-medical counseling will be available via phone and video.
Support for Children and Youth:
- Family non-medical counseling is available via video for minors ages 6-12.
Parent or guardian MUST attend each session.
- Individual non-medical counseling is available via video for minors ages
13-17. Parent or guardian MUST be available at the start of each video
session to give parental consent and provide line of sight requirements.
In-person appointments will follow accepted social distancing procedures.
MFLC services are available to Active Duty service members and their family
members, National Guard and reservists and their family members, and
retirees within 180 days of separation.
